Canucks rally past the Predators 4-3 in a shootout on DeBrusk’s winner
- On Thursday, the Vancouver Canucks beat the Nashville Predators 4-3 at Rogers Arena after a scoreless overtime, with Jake DeBrusk scoring the winning shootout goal.
- Trailing 3-1 after two periods, Marco Rossi scored with 4:05 left and Filip Hronek tied the game at 1:01 with the goalie pulled to force overtime.
- Juuse Saros made 23 saves and became the second NHL goalie to reach 50 starts this season, while Tyson Jost scored twice and rookie Matthew Wood scored at Rogers Arena.
- The Nashville Predators remain locked in a wild-card race with 17 games remaining, as Vancouver hosts the Seattle Kraken on Saturday and Nashville visits the Edmonton Oilers on Sunday.
- Takeaways noted Brock Boeser's goal was his 16th of the year and fourth in five games, and Evander Kane returned after missing one game.
